All I know is New Orleans Affordable Housing was awarded a contract between 2 and 4 million dollars to gut and remediate homes.

3319 Law

While I was out surveying houses today I shot one of the houses that had been gutted by the NOAH program. It is also on the City Demolition list, the Imminent Health threat list.

So to recap, the City spent CBDG funds to clean out the house and then spends FEMA funds to demolish it. The other comical element is that the signs are NEW and they still have Donna Addkison listed as a City employee. In the last 2 years I have seen 4 of these signs and all of them in the last month.
